Sudan's prime minister and other Sudanese officials are detained in an apparent coup

This May 7, 2021, file photo shows U.S. Special Envoy for the Horn of Africa Jeffrey Feltman in Khartoum, Sudan. Sudanese officials say military forces detained at least five senior government officials Monday. Feltman met with Sudanese military and civilian leaders Saturday and Sunday in efforts to resolve a growing dispute.

The whereabouts of Prime Minister Abdalla Hamdok were not immediately known, according to Sudan's information ministry. At the same time, the internet in the country has been cut off.
